Description: Sets the modulator mode.
Value: 0: Automatic changeover SVM/FLB
2: Space vector modulation (SVM)
3: SVM without overcontrol
4: SVM/FLB without overcontrol
10: SVM/FLB with modulation depth reduction
Dependency: If a sine-wave filter is parameterized as output filter (p0230 = 3, 4), then only space vector modulation without over-
control can be selected as modulation type (p1802 = 3). This is not valid for the power units PM260. p1802 = 10 can
only be set for the PM230 and PM240 power units.
Refer to: p0230, p0500
Note: When modulation modes are enabled that could lead to overmodulation (p1802 = 0, 2, 10), the modulation depth
must be limited using p1803 (pre-assignment, p1803 = 98%). The higher the overmodulation, the greater the cur-
rent ripple and torque ripple. With p1802 = 10, the modulation depth limit is automatically reduced to 100% in the
critical output frequency range (over approx. 57 Hz).
When changing p1802[x], the values for all of the other existing indices are also changed.
